Stoke-on-Trent has a rich industrial history, particularly known for its pottery production, which includes famous names like Royal Doulton and Wedgwood. In recent years, the city has hosted various cultural events, including the annual Stoke-on-Trent Literary Festival and the British Ceramics Biennial, showcasing local artistry and innovation. Additionally, the regeneration of the city center has led to the opening of new attractions such as the Spode Museum and the Cultural Quarter, highlighting its evolving identity.
